冬种多花黑麦草与稻田六足动物多样性关系初探 被引量:2

Relationship between Planting Italian Ryegrass during Winter and Hexapod Community in Rice Habitat

摘要 2008年11月至2010年6月,对珠海市农业技术推广站稻田及周围杂草以及冬种黑麦草田3种不同生境的节肢动物越冬群落进行系统调查,共鉴定出六足动物10目57科78种。水稻种植期稻田以双翅目和同翅目为优势种类,而杂草地以双翅目为优势种类。冬种黑麦草田以双翅目和膜翅目为优势种类,杂草地以膜翅目、缨翅目和双翅目为优势种类。每次取样的Shannon-Wiener多样性指数(H)在2.30~3.20之间,Pielou均匀性指数(J)在0.72~0.86之间,但水稻成熟后会影响均匀度。优势度指数(C)均在0.25以下。水稻生长期和冬闲期各种指数没有明显的差异。水稻种植期期间,黑麦草田与对照田Jaccard相似性指数最高,但在冬闲期,杂草地与黑麦草田更高。 From Nov. 2008 to Jun. 2010, an ecological investigation on Hexapoda was carried out in rice habitat and non-rice habitat in Agricultural Technology Extension Station, Zhuhai, Guangdong Province. A total of 78 species of Hexapoda, which belong to 57 familes, 10 orders, were obtained. The results show that Diptera and Homoptera are dominant in rice field, but only Diptera is dominant in weeds during rice growing. Diptera and Hemynoptera are dominant in Italian ryegrass field in winter. However, Hemynoptera, Thysanoptera and Diptera are dominant in weeds. Shannon-Wiener diversity index (H) is 2.30 - 3.20. Pielou-evenness (J) is 0. 72 - 0.86, but the value would be changed when rice maturing Simpson dominance index is below 0. 25. There is no distinct difference on the three indices between rice growing season and winter time. Jaceard similarity index is higher in Italian ryegrass field and control field during rice growing, but higher in Italian ryegrass field and weeds in winter.
